Former England captain David Beckham is to retire at the end of the season.



The 38-year-old signed a five-month deal at Paris St-Germain in January and donated all of his salary to charity.
Beckham joined Manchester United as a 14-year-old and made 398 appearances, winning six Premier League titles and the Champions League.
"I'm thankful to PSG for giving me the opportunity to continue but I feel now is the right time to finish my career, playing at the highest level," he said.
Including PSG's recent Ligue 1 title win, Beckham has won 19 trophies - 10 of them league titles - in a playing career spanning 20 years, and is the only English player to win championships in four countries.
